Juliana Pattermann-Gunsch, BA MA MSc, is a Teaching & Research Assistant at MCI | The Entrepreneurial School® in the Department of Business Administration Online and a Junior Researcher with the UNESCO Chair in Futures Capability in Innovation and Entrepreneurship. Her research focuses on higher education and futures studies, with a particular emphasis on Futures Literacy and its development through innovative teaching and learning arrangements. Following her studies in international business and business education, she has been involved in teaching at vocational secondary schools, universities, and universities of applied sciences, and has contributed to the curricular development of higher education programs. In addition, she designs and facilitates educational formats for small and medium-sized enterprises. As part of her project work, she has been involved in the development of the FuturesComp competence framework and has contributed to national and international research projects, such as the Interreg project 'AlpBioEco' and the FFG-funded project DIH West.
